Goal

To create a link from the Oracle Applications 11i home page to a Discoverer workbook that will automatically open Discoverer Plus or Viewer and display the workbook using apps security.

Note: Due to changes in the code for Discoverer Viewer 10.1.2 these steps may not work. Some customers have been able to get workbooks and a default sheet to open automatically from applications. The author of this note has not been able to get this functionality to work with Viewer version 10.1.2. The steps that others have done to open a workbook in Viewer 10.1.2 are included for anyone to try but are not guaranteed to work at this time.

 

Note: The steps in Discoverer setup Note 313418.1 - "Using Discoverer 10.1.2 with Oracle E-Business Suite 11i" - must be finished successfully before logging a Service Request against this note.
